Why You Might Need to Factory Reset Your Honeywell NVR

While a Honeywell NVR factory reset is a powerful solution, it's not a step to be taken lightly. Understanding the common scenarios that necessitate it can help you decide if it's the right move for your situation.

Forgotten Passwords and Account Lockouts

This is perhaps the most common reason. If you've forgotten the administrator password for your Honeywell NVR and exhausted all recovery options, a factory reset is often the only way to regain access. It will revert the password to its default (often 'admin' or '12345'), allowing you to log in and set a new, secure password.

Troubleshooting System Glitches and Errors

NVRs, like any complex electronic device, can experience software bugs, configuration conflicts, or persistent errors that hinder their performance. If your Honeywell NVR is freezing, not recording correctly, or exhibiting erratic behavior despite other troubleshooting efforts, a factory reset can clear corrupt data and restore system stability.

Preparing for a Sale or Transfer

If you're upgrading your surveillance system or selling your Honeywell NVR, performing a factory reset is crucial for data privacy and security. This ensures that all previous recordings, user accounts, and personal settings are completely wiped from the device, protecting your sensitive information.

Starting Fresh with New Configurations

Sometimes, a system becomes so intricately configured that it's simpler to start from scratch. A Honeywell NVR factory reset provides a clean slate, allowing you to set up your cameras and network settings from the ground up, which can be beneficial after a major network change or system redesign.

Data Backup is Crucial

Warning: A factory reset will erase ALL data on your NVR, including recorded video footage, user settings, network configurations, and camera pairing information. If you have any critical footage or configurations you wish to preserve, you MUST back them up to an external storage device (e.g., USB drive, network storage) before proceeding.

Understanding the Impact

After the reset, your NVR will return to its original factory settings. This means you will need to re-configure all network settings (IP address, gateway, DNS), re-add and re-pair your cameras, and set up new user accounts and passwords. Be prepared for a complete reinstallation process.

Necessary Tools and Information

Gather any necessary tools beforehand. This might include:

  • Your Honeywell NVR's power adapter.
  • A small, pointed object (like a paperclip or toothpick) for physical reset buttons.
  • Access to a monitor and mouse connected to the NVR (for software methods).
  • Your NVR's user manual, which often contains specific reset instructions for your model.

General Steps for a Honeywell NVR Factory Reset (Software Method)

If you still have access to the NVR's interface, you can usually perform a Honeywell NVR factory reset through its software menu. This is the preferred method as it's less intrusive.

  1. Connect and Log In: Connect your NVR to a monitor and mouse. Power it on and log in using your administrator credentials (if you know them). If you've forgotten the password, this method won't work, and you'll need to consider the hardware reset.
  2. Navigate to System Settings: Once logged in, use the mouse to right-click on the main screen to bring up the menu. Look for "Main Menu," "System," "Configuration," or similar options.
  3. Find Reset/Default Option: Within the system settings, search for options related to "Restore Defaults," "Factory Reset," "System Reset," or "Maintenance." These are typically found under categories like "System," "Maintenance," or "Advanced Settings."
  4. Confirm the Reset: The system will likely prompt you with a warning message, emphasizing that all data will be lost. Read it carefully and confirm your decision. You might need to enter the administrator password again to authorize the reset.
  5. Wait for Reboot: The NVR will begin the reset process, which may take several minutes. It will then automatically reboot to its factory default state.

Performing a Hard Factory Reset on Your Honeywell NVR (Hardware Method)

When software access is impossible (e.g., forgotten password), a hard or physical Honeywell NVR factory reset is your alternative. This typically involves using a small reset button on the device itself.

Locating the Reset Button

The location of the reset button varies significantly between Honeywell NVR models.

  • External: Some models have a small, pinhole-sized button on the back panel, side, or front.
  • Internal: Many Honeywell NVRs require you to open the casing to find the reset button on the main circuit board. This often means removing screws and gently detaching the top cover.

Consult your specific Honeywell NVR model's user manual or support documentation for the exact location of the reset button. It might be labeled "RESET" or "SW."

The Reset Process

  1. Power Off: Crucially, power off your Honeywell NVR completely by disconnecting the power adapter.
  2. Press and Hold: Locate the reset button. Using a paperclip or a similar pointed object, press and hold the reset button.
  3. Power On (While Holding): While continuously holding down the reset button, reconnect the power adapter to turn on the NVR.
  4. Continue Holding: Keep the reset button pressed for approximately 10-30 seconds. You might see indicator lights flash or hear beeps. The exact duration can vary, so check your manual.
  5. Release and Reboot: Release the reset button. The NVR should then reboot itself, returning to its factory default settings.

What to Do After a Successful Honeywell NVR Factory Reset

Congratulations, your Honeywell NVR factory reset is complete! Now it's time to set it up again.

Initial Setup and Configuration

When the NVR reboots, it will likely prompt you to go through an initial setup wizard, just like when it was new.

  • Set New Password: Immediately set a strong, unique administrator password. Do NOT leave it at the default.
  • Network Settings: Configure your NVR's IP address, subnet mask, gateway, and DNS servers to match your network. You may want to assign a static IP.
  • Date and Time: Set the correct date, time, and time zone.

Restoring Your Backup (if applicable)

If you backed up your video footage or configurations, now is the time to restore them. Connect your external storage device and use the NVR's menu options to import the data.

Updating Firmware

It's always a good practice to check for and install the latest firmware updates for your Honeywell NVR. Firmware updates often include security patches, bug fixes, and performance enhancements. Visit the official Honeywell security website, search for your specific NVR model, and follow the instructions for firmware updates.
